Traditional Wood Fencing A Classic Choice in Fencing

Featheredge panels furnish a classic and timeless look for any fence. Constructed from sturdy wood, these panels comprise overlapping slats that create a distinctive aesthetic. Featheredge fencing is highly regarded for its durability and ability to withstand Low-Maintenance Fencing Panels the elements. Its classic design seamlessly blends with a variety of architectural styles, making it a popular choice for both residential and commercial properties.

  • Moreover, featheredge panels are relatively simple to install and maintain.
  • They can be stained or painted to match your existing decor.

Lattice Panel Options

When considering fencing options, choosing the right panel style can dramatically impact both its appearance and functionality. Two popular choices include trellis, slatted, and featheredge panels, each offering unique advantages and aesthetic appeals. Trellis panels feature a crisscross design, providing excellent structure for climbing plants while enhancing a decorative touch to your landscape. Slatted panels offer a more classic look with their straight, parallel slats, creating privacy and offering shade. Featheredge panels, characterized by their interlocking boards, boast a timeless appearance and strong sturdiness.

  • Ultimately, the best panel style for your needs depends on factors such as your desired level of privacy, aesthetic preference, and intended use.
